Maintenance and safety considerations
Regular checks for loose fittings, cleaning to maintain clarity of glass and prompt repair of any chips or scratches are essential. Safety standards require gates to close automatically and lock securely, with appropriate height and reach to deter climbing. Clear glass, tempered for strength, helps maintain visibility around the pool area, making routine supervision straightforward for families and guests alike.
Installation tips from seasoned pros
Professional installers assess site conditions, including slope, drainage and fence line alignment, to ensure a compliant and sturdy result. They also account for glass bond integrity, frame corrosion resistance and post spacing. A well-planned installation minimizes future maintenance while maximising the aesthetic cohesion of outdoor spaces, from pool deck to garden borders.
